Oare is a popular and thriving village set between Marlborough and Pewsey and offering a church, a village hall and excellent pre-school and primary education. More extensive facilities can be found in Pewsey (2 miles) and Marlborough (5 miles) with a wide range of cultural, education and leisure facilities. Trains from London Paddington are from Pewsey (just over an hour) and motorway access to the north to the M4 and to the south the A303/M3. The Kennet and Avon canal runs close by.
